Enhancing Engagement Through Strategic Partnerships

Strategic partnerships are no longer simply beneficial add-ons but rather integral components of success in the modern entertainment industry. Collaborations allow companies to leverage each other’s strengths, expand their reach, and access new markets. These alliances can take various forms, from co-production agreements and joint marketing campaigns to technology licensing and data sharing initiatives. The key to a successful partnership lies in identifying complementary assets and aligning strategic goals. This extends beyond simple resource pooling; it requires a shared vision and a commitment to mutual growth. Companies that prioritize building strong relationships with key players are better positioned to navigate the complexities of the rapidly evolving entertainment landscape. They foster resilience and ensure long-term viability.

One of the primary benefits of strategic partnerships is the ability to mitigate risk. Developing new entertainment products and services requires significant investment, and there’s always a degree of uncertainty involved. By sharing the financial burden and expertise, companies can reduce their exposure to potential losses. Furthermore, partnerships can accelerate the innovation process by bringing together diverse perspectives and skill sets. This collaborative approach often leads to the development of more creative and compelling offerings. For example, a gaming company partnering with a streaming service can offer exclusive content and reach a wider audience, resulting in increased revenue and brand awareness for both parties. This synergy is crucial for maintaining a competitive edge.

The Impact of AI and Machine Learning

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) are playing an increasingly important role in personalization. AI-powered alg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data to identify patterns and predict user behavior with remarkable accuracy. These algorithms can be used to recommend content, personalize advertising, and even create customized experiences. ML allows systems to learn from data without being explicitly programmed, continuously improving their performance over time. This adaptive capability is crucial for delivering truly personalized experiences. As AI and ML technologies continue to evolve, they will become even more integral to the personalization process.

Furthermore, AI and ML can automate many of the tasks associated with personalization, freeing up human resources to focus on more strategic initiatives. For example, AI-powered chatbots can provide personalized customer support, while ML algorithms can optimize content delivery based on real-time user feedback. This automation allows companies to scale their personalization efforts and reach a wider audience. It’s a powerful combination of technology and efficiency that is transforming the entertainment industry.

The Convergence of Gaming and Entertainment

The lines between gaming and traditional entertainment are becoming increasingly blurred. Games are no longer just a niche hobby; they are a mainstream form of entertainment enjoyed by millions of people around the world. Furthermore, game technologies and techniques are being adopted by other forms of entertainment, such as film and television. Interactive storytelling, branching narratives, and gamified experiences are becoming more common in these mediums. This convergence is creating new opportunities for innovation and collaboration. The expertise of game developers is highly sought after by companies seeking to create more engaging and interactive experiences.

This convergence also extends to the monetization models. In-game purchases, subscriptions, and virtual events are becoming increasingly common in the gaming industry. These models are also being adopted by other forms of entertainment, such as streaming services and online concerts. The ability to monetize engagement is crucial for the long-term sustainability of these businesses. It allows them to invest in new content and technologies, further enhancing the user experience.
